Lack of Regulatory Requirements for Supplement Testing in New Zealand

In New Zealand, there is currently no requirement for companies to independently test their supplement products. It is up to the company selling the supplements to ensure that they are safe to use. Unless the company is regularly testing their products and sharing the results, consumers of supplements have no way to know that they are free of harmful substances, or even contain what they say they do!

Trusted Testing with Hill Laboratories

We use Hill Laboratories to test for heavy metals, pesticides, and microbials. They are IANZ accredited, NZ owned and operated, and have been providing testing services for over 40 years. They use state-of-the-art technology to detect contaminants at minute levels.

Potency Guaranteed with Massey University

We also test all our mushroom extract capsule products for potency, and we do this by verifying the proportion of beta-glucans in the extract, which are the main active compounds. This testing is performed by Massey University on our behalf, using the Megazyme test to accurately verify the potency of our capsules.
